Slot Number
12975848
Finalized
Epoch Number
Status
proposed
Age
81 days 6 hrs ago (Nov-07-2025 04:49:59 PM +UTC)

BlockRoot Hash
0xa1967fa7ca0edaff030c5862443e62243ded38a5e5bddca947e18d8b4db738d8
State Root
0xdd40481eae9592617b736129dfaf4cc41f8a83ad495535b71f8c4c771b27f000

Randao Reveal
0x8178339b3d155a448b843f021a3f5069800d0c42ac2ab65bfaff50c041760a8dd4756cd7ecabd07de5cd21f79829f80c0f895b4a57ccca4199adb36aca746b9953d589d8e829ef3bdbadc287c8c8948a2ee5e564f3e02951c1e12c7391e113a8

Graffiti
(Hex:0x636861726f6e2f76312e372e302d336163366263390000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x91e193b1972ae99652a353091c2afb0e33b915e1bdbf148e342525c78b0b27369dd23735e79c9707eb88d2e7364d0d9c077498741666a5da978ed69b97758badda510e10668474db668534741453efc8741fce5728c45d72329ed3ca9fa02086

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ators